Output d964db45577545a9c36ff0e6768a1bd632c502af64fea322fc7affcb9242f09e:52

value
2595419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b84efe68525d3b91942155130c3b420e4fe61f83 OP_EQUAL
address
MQhhCJzSJvb4yKwCaaJDHaL3uB7z8v9YPj
transaction
d964db45577545a9c36ff0e6768a1bd632c502af64fea322fc7affcb9242f09e
spent
true